Colleagues dump man in Ib river suspecting him dead in Odisha

KalingaTV News Network

Jharsuguda: In a shocking incident, a 44-year-old man was dumped into Ib river from Ramtela bridge by his colleagues last night.

One Gautam Bhandare, who was working as a labourer in the Odisha Power Generation Corporation Limited (OPGC) plant at Banaharpali of Jharsuguda district, fell sick last night, following which he was being taken to Burla hospital in a Bolero vehicle by four of his co-workers. However, when Bhandare stopped breathing on the mid-way, his colleagues, suspecting him to be dead, threw him into Ib river from the Rampela Bridge.

After learning about the incident, Banharpali police detained the four persons including driver of the vehicle and are questioning them.

Meanwhile, a rescue operation has been initiated by the local administration with the help of police, firefighters and Odisha Disaster Rapid Action Force (ODRAF) team.
